Point out a difference and similarity between interest group and movement.

Open in App
Solution

  • An interest group is a group of people who share the same agenda and interest. It is different from a movement because the membership of a movement is not limited, there is an open door policy for membership to join the movement. The pubic opinion decides the momentum and fate of a movement.
  • Public interest group sees the interest of the public in general and wider issues whereas sectional interest groups see the interest of particular section of society.
  • Both interest group and movement group share the same idea of catering to the interest of general public.
